A B.Sc. with honours in statistics is offered by many colleges in Delhi. Some choices based on your 12th grade PCM score of 51% are as follows

With a competitive cutoff based on entrance exams and 12th-grade grades, Miranda House is well-known for its robust academic programs.
For students who achieve well in their 12th grade, Shivaji College offers a B.Sc. in Statistics with a reasonably reasonable cutoff.
With a cutoff that changes annually, Kamla Nehru College is an additional alternative that offers a B.Sc. (Hons) in Statistics.
Indraprastha College for Women: Provides top-notch resources and statistics teachers
